     Industrial stovesThe electric stove is an indispensable member of the family. They convert electric energy efficiently into thermal energy through electrical resistance, arc heating or induction heating. The temperature control of the furnace is more precise and flexible than that of the traditional gas stoves, which are particularly suitable for temperature-sensitive process scenarios。
    Ii. Common industrial stove types
    Electrical resistance furnaces: heat generation from electrical resistance materials using currents for metal thermal treatment
    Arc furnaces: high temperatures generated through inter-polar discharges, mainly for steel smelting
    Sensors: heated metals with electromagnetic induction, commonly found in precision casting
    Electronic beam furnaces: high-energy electronic beam bomb material for special alloy smelting
    Industrial advantages of stoves
    In addition to being clean and environmentally friendly, electric stoves have several practical advantages:
    Warming speed, heat efficiency above 60%
    Temperature regulates the width of the range up to ±1°c
    High level of automation to achieve procedural control
    Work environment friendly, no light fire, no emissions
    Simple maintenance, longer useful life

    Industrial furnaces usually provide controlled and even heating conditions in closed rooms, often accompanied by temperature control cabinets to achieve automatic or manual temperature control, with a rated working temperature range of 600°c to 1800°c。
